age based risk factors for pediatric atv related fatalities
Pediatrics, 2014Co-Authors: Gerene M Denning, Karisa K Harland, Charles A JennissenAbstract:OBJECTIVES: To compare and contrast characteristics and determinants of fatal All-Terrain Vehicle (ATV) crashes among pediatric age groups. METHODS: Retrospective descriptive and multivariable analyses of Consumer Product Safety Commission fatality data (1985-2009) were performed. RESULTS: Relative to 1985-1989 (baseline), pediatric deaths over the subsequent 4-year periods were lower until 2001-2004, when they markedly increased. Also, the proportion of Vehicles involved in fatalities with engine sizes >350 cubic centimeter increased, reaching ∼50% of crashes in 2007-2009. Ninety-five percent of all pediatric fatalities were on adult-size Vehicles. Victims CONCLUSIONS: There were significant differences between pediatric age groups in the relative contribution of known risk factors for ATV-related fatalities. Future injury prevention efforts must recognize these differences and develop interventions based on the age range targeted. Language: en

a school based study of adolescent all terrain Vehicle exposure safety behaviors and crash experience
Annals of Family Medicine, 2014Co-Authors: Charles A Jennissen, Karisa K Harland, Kristel Wetjen, Jeffrey Peck, Pam Hoogerwerf, Gerene M DenningAbstract:PURPOSE: More youth are killed every year in the United States in All-Terrain Vehicle (ATV) crashes than on bicycles, and since 2001, one-fifth of all ATV fatalities have involved victims aged 15 years or younger. Effectively preventing pediatric ATV-related deaths and injuries requires knowledge about youth riding practices. Our objective was to examine ATV use, crash prevalence, and riding behaviors among adolescent students in a rural state. METHODS: We administered a cross-sectional survey to 4,684 youths aged 11 to 16 years at 30 schools across Iowa from November 2010 to April 2013. Descriptive and comparative analyses were performed. RESULTS: Regardless of rurality, at least 75% of students reported having been on an ATV, with 38% of those riding daily or weekly. Among ATV riders, 57% had been in a crash. Most riders engaged in risky behaviors, including riding with passengers (92%), on public roads (81%), or without a helmet (64%). Almost 60% reported engaging in all 3 behaviors; only 2% engaged in none. Multivariable modeling revealed male youth, students riding daily/weekly, and those reporting both riding on public roads and with passengers were 1.61 (95% CI, 1.36-1.91), 3.73 (95% CI, 3.10-4.50), and 3.24 (95% CI, 2.09-5.04) times more likely to report a crash, respectively. CONCLUSIONS: Three-fourths of youths surveyed were exposed to ATVs. The majority of riders had engaged in unsafe behaviors and experienced a crash. Given this widespread use and the potentially considerable morbidity of pediatric ATV crashes, prevention efforts, including anticipatory guidance by primary care clinicians serving families at risk, should be a higher priority. all terrain Vehicles on the road a serious traffic safety concern
Injury Prevention, 2012Co-Authors: Charles A Jennissen, Karisa K Harland, Christopher T Buresh, D Ellis, Gerene M DenningAbstract:Background On-road All-Terrain Vehicle (ATV) crashes are frequent despite most US states having laws restricting road use. Aims/Objectives/Purpose To determine the demographics, and the mechanisms and outcomes of injuries of on-road versus off-road ATV crashes. Methods Data from our Iowa ATV injury surveillance database (2002–2009) was derived and statistically analysed. Results/Outcomes 976 records were studied, with 38% of injured individuals from on-road crashes. Demographics were similar at each location. Females and youths under 16 were over four times more likely to be passengers (p 15 (p Significance/Contribution to the Field On-road crashes were significantly more likely to involve collision with another Vehicle, suggesting on-road ATVs represent a traffic safety concern. Even controlling for helmet use, on-road crash victims suffered more severe injuries than those off-road. Our data reinforces the importance of laws restricting ATV road use and their enforcement, and the need to increase ATV user education about the dangers of on-road riding.

state specific atv related fatality rates an update in the new millennium
Public Health Reports, 2012Co-Authors: James C Helmkamp, Mary E Aitken, James Graham, Corey R CampbellAbstract:OBJECTIVES: We compared state-specific All-Terrain Vehicle (ATV) fatality rates from 2000-2007 with 1990-1999 data, grouping states according to helmet, training, and licensure requirements. METHODS: We used the CDC WONDER online database to identify ATV cases from 2000-2007 and calculate rates per 100,000 population by state, gender, and age. RESULTS: ATV deaths (n=7,231) occurred at a rate of 0.32 per 100,000 population. Males accounted for 86% of ATV-related deaths at a rate that was six times that for females (0.55 vs. 0.09 per 100,000 population, respectively); 60% of the male deaths occurred in the 15- to 44-year age group. With the exception of the two oldest age categories, rates were consistently higher in the no-helmet-law group. Both the number and rate of ATV-related deaths increased more than threefold between 1990-1999 and 2000-2007. West Virginia and Alaska continue to have the highest ATV fatality rates (1.63 and 2.67 ATV deaths per 100,000 population, respectively). CONCLUSIONS: Helmet-use requirements seem to slightly mitigate ATV-related death, but training requirements do not. For policy to be effective, it must be enforced. Language: en

atv and bicycle deaths and associated costs in the united states 2000 2005
Public Health Reports, 2009Co-Authors: James C Helmkamp, Mary E Aitken, Bruce A LawrenceAbstract:OBJECTIVE: We determined the rate and costs of recent U.S. All-Terrain Vehicle (ATV) and bicycle deaths. METHODS: Fatalities were identified from the National Center for Health Statistics Multiple Cause-of-Death public-access file. ATV and bicycle deaths were defined by International Classification of Diseases, 10th Revision codes V86.0-V86.9 and V10-V19, respectively. Lifetime costs were estimated using standard methods such as those used by the National Highway Traffic Safety Administration. RESULTS: From 2000 through 2005, 5,204 people died from ATV crashes and 4,924 from bicycle mishaps. A mean of 694 adults and 174 children died annually from ATV injuries, while 666 adults and 155 children died from bicycle injuries. Death rates increased among adult ATV and bike riders and child ATV riders. Males had higher fatality rates for both ATVs and bicycles. Among children, total costs increased 15% for ATV deaths and decreased 23% for bicycle deaths. In adults, ATV costs increased 45% and bike costs increased 39%. CONCLUSIONS: Bicycle- and ATV-related deaths and associated costs are high and, for the most part, increasing. Promotion of proven prevention strategies, including helmet use, is indicated. However, enforcement of helmet laws is problematic, which may contribute to observed trends. Language: en
